python实现接口自动化测试中如何使用pymysql直连数据库

这篇文章给大家介绍python实现接口自动化测试中如何使用pyMySQL直连数据库,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。

我们拥有10多年网页设计和网站建设经验,从网站策划到网站制作,我们的网页设计师为您提供的解决方案。为企业提供成都做网站、网站制作、成都外贸网站建设、微信开发、微信小程序定制开发、手机网站制作设计H5高端网站建设、等业务。无论您有什么样的网站设计或者设计方案要求,我们都将富于创造性的提供专业设计服务并满足您的需求。

实现步骤

1 PyMySQL 安装

启动命令行,联网的前提下键入命令: pip install pymysql

python实现接口自动化测试中如何使用pymysql直连数据库

2 PyMySQL 基本实现流程简介

  1. 导入第三方

  • import pymysql

  1. 创建连接,配置连接信息 conn = pymysql.Connect(host="127.0.0.1", port=3306, database="books",

  • user="root", password="root",

  • charset="utf8")

  1. 创建数据操作载体对象_ cursor 游标 cursor = conn.cursor()

  2. 按照需求,编写并执行 sql 语句

  • 首先,声明 SQL 语句

  • sql = "select * from t_book"

  • 然后,通过 cursor 对象将 SQL 语句发送到数据库

  • cursor.execute(sql)

  • 最后,通过 cursor 对象获取响应结果

  • print("行数:",cursor.rowcount)#获取行数

  • print("第一条:",cursor.fetchone())# 获取单条数据

  1. 最后释放资源

  • cursor.close()

  • conn.close()

关于python实现接口自动化测试中如何使用pymysql直连数据库就分享到这里了,希望以上内容可以对大家有一定的帮助,可以学到更多知识。如果觉得文章不错,可以把它分享出去让更多的人看到。


当前题目:python实现接口自动化测试中如何使用pymysql直连数据库
文章源于:http://myzitong.com/article/pjiegs.html